敬畏主就是智慧;远离恶便是聪明

然而,智慧有何处可寻?聪明之处在哪里呢? (约伯记 28:12 和合本)
But where can wisdom be found? Where does understanding dwell?  (Job 28:12 NIV)
智慧从何处来呢?聪明之处在哪里呢? (约伯记 28:20 和合本)
Where then does wisdom come from? Where does understanding dwell?  (Job 28:20 NIV)
 神明白智慧的道路,晓得智慧的所在。 (约伯记 28:23 和合本)
God understands the way to it and he alone knows where it dwells,  (Job 28:23 NIV)
因他鉴察直到地极,遍观普天之下, (约伯记 28:24 和合本)
for he views the ends of the earth and sees everything under the heavens.  (Job 28:24 NIV)
要为风定轻重,又度量诸水; (约伯记 28:25 和合本)
When he established the force of the wind and measured out the waters,  (Job 28:25 NIV)
他为雨露定命令,为雷电定道路。 (约伯记 28:26 和合本)
when he made a decree for the rain and a path for the thunderstorm,  (Job 28:26 NIV)
那时他看见智慧,而且述说;他坚定,并且查究。 (约伯记 28:27 和合本)
then he looked at wisdom and appraised it; he confirmed it and tested it.  (Job 28:27 NIV)
他对人说:敬畏主就是智慧;远离恶便是聪明。 (约伯记 28:28 和合本)
And he said to the human race, “The fear of the Lord—that is wisdom, and to shun evil is understanding.”  (Job 28:28 NIV)
